New Financial Instrument Listing - ACL217

ABSA BANK LIMITED
Bond Code: ACL217
ISIN No: ZAG000109794
NEW FINANCIAL INSTRUMENT LISTING
The JSE Limited has granted a financial instrument listing to ABSA BANK LIMITED “ACL217 NOTES”
under its Credit Linked Note Programme.


INSTRUMENT TYPE:                                     CREDIT LINKED NOTE

Authorised Programme size                            R20,000,000,000.00
Total Notes in Issue                                 R12 036 235 496
Full Note details are as follows:
Bond Code                                            ACL217
Nominal Issued                                       R10,000,000.00
Coupon Rate                                          3 month JIBAR plus 211 bps (or 2.11%)
Trade Type                                           Price
First Interest Payment Date                          20 December 2013
Scheduled Maturity                                   20 December 2023
Interest Payment Dates                               20 March, 20 June, 20 September and 20 December
Books Close                                          10 March, 10 June, 10 September and 10 December
Last Day to Register                                 by 17h00 on 9 March, 9 June, 9 September and
                                                     9 December
Date Issued                                          7 October 2013
ISIN No.                                             ZAG000109794
